Life at Intel link: /content/www/us/en/jobs/life-at-intel. html As a Facilities Power Distribution Electrical Engineer your responsibilities will include but are not limited to: Act as one of Intel's System Owner of the site's electrical operations and associated distribution system. Model the electrical power distribution system and track changes. Troubleshoot electrical system problems, conducting breaker coordination
and arc flash studies, track electrical load and capacity, utilizing Easy Power system software.
Deliver operational efficiency, maintenance, testing, and commissioning solutions. Identify, qualify, and implement system upgrades. Provide technical leadership to 3rd party support. Respond to power outages and disturbances and lead the recovery effort. Participate in cross site teams. Track, trend and analyze electrical system usage utilizing PME and ION power monitoring software. Some travel and rotational on call weekend engineering support will also be required. Review and approve all electrical designs supporting the facility, effective collaboration with Project Managers and Project Engineers, architects, engineers and contractors on new construction/renovation projects.
Review electrical design specifications, submittals, studies and drawings. Possess thorough knowledge of low and medium voltage electrical distribution systems including transformers, low voltage substations, generators, and UPS systems, ability to review and challenge cost estimates, budgets and ROI analysis. Knowledge of the latest NEC codes, including life safety and building code, with skills to read and interpret design drawings and specifications. Minimum Qualifications: Bachelor's degree in Electrical Engineering or similar technical degree with 4+ years of experience in low and medium voltage electrical power system (35k V and 12.47) maintenance, design, and/or operation.
This includes electrical modeling, reviewing equipment drawings and/or submittals, troubleshooting electrical equipment issues, implementing protective device coordination studies, and/or load flow analysis. Preferred Qualifications: Master's degree in Electrical Engineering or similar technical degree with 2+ year of experience in low and medium voltage electrical power system (35k V and 12.47) maintenance, design, and/or operation. This includes electrical modeling, reviewing equipment drawings and submittals, troubleshooting electrical equipment issues, implementing protective device coordination studies, and load flow analysis.
6+ years of experience with: Maintenance, design, and/or operation of electrical switchgear, transformers, VFD's, diesel generators, static/rotary UPS, and low voltage distribution equipment in a critical facility or high-tech manufacturing facility.
